OPMs Early Career Talent Network: A New Dawn for Federal Recruitment
The Office of Personnel Management (OPM) has launched the Early Career Talent Network (ECTN) to attract fresh talent for roles in finance, HR, project management, and engineering across government agencies. This initiative comes after significant federal workforce cuts, ordered by DOGE, and is fully backed by the White House. The ECTN aims to rebuild the team and create a solid talent pipeline, connecting sharp minds to public service jobs that benefit everyday Americans. As agencies navigate retirement processing delays and strive to maintain efficiency, the ECTN is poised to reshape federal recruitment.
